Transaction deaafbe4ce372120163c402f6aca8dc7aee2f0158b6911762f40b3d022862600
1 Input
1 Output
-
deaafbe4ce372120163c402f6aca8dc7aee2f0158b6911762f40b3d022862600:0
- value
- 249887311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da47428e913761ebe9519e422b54941851663c5f OP_EQUAL
- address
- 3MbAbbNwZ5Q4qWgUFhMHUUGnSQjwzuEyNC